Embodiment Construction

[0021] The embodiments described below provide an end effector that enhances the movement of the disk or substrate throughout the manufacturing process. The end effector can access the disc in a vertical or horizontal position and move the disc to the horizontal or vertical position respectively. In addition, these embodiments can employ servo motors or stepper motors with feedback to quickly and smoothly transport the HDD from one planar orientation to another while reducing, minimizing or eliminating jerking. Jumping is a common phenomenon when using pneumatic air cylinders for motion control. Because jumping may cause damage to HDD, jumping is not good for HDD handling. However, past measures taken to mitigate runout have resulted in increased handling / delivery times. The end effector is also compliant or compliant with respect to the extension and retraction mechanism and electric motor that provide the pivotal movement. Abstract

An apparatus for transporting a substrate is provided. The apparatus includes an upper portion housing an electric motor, the electric motor having a drive shaft. A motor housing encloses the electric motor. A pivot bracket having a first end and a second end, where the first end of the pivot bracket is coupled to the drive shaft. The apparatus includes a lower portion having a top surface affixed to the second end of the pivot bracket. The lower portion includes a plurality of paddle assemblies each having support extensions extending though a bearing assembly of the lower portion. Each of the paddle assemblies has an independent drive assembly disposed between corresponding support extensions, wherein the lower portion translates between a vertical and horizontal orientation by pivoting around an axis of the driveshaft.

Description

Background technique [0001] Saving HDDs of less than a second in conveyance / shipping time for movement of hard disk drive disk (HDD) platters or substrates throughout the manufacturing process translates into higher throughput, which is a real gain competitive advantage. For example, where HDDs are tested after completing certain manufacturing processes, the movement of HDDs to and from the test station can become a bottleneck. Any improvement in handling / delivery time will result in a substantial improvement in yield. [0002] Therefore, there is a need for hard drive manufacturers to provide a tool that minimizes or reduces handling / shipping time. Contents of the invention [0003] Broadly speaking, the present invention meets these needs by providing an end effector that reduces transit time.
